POSITION TITLE: Behavior Analyst Associate

PAY RANGE: $27.00-$34.09 PER HOUR

REPORTS TO: Director of Clinical Services

DESCRIPTION OF POSITION:

The Behavior Analyst Associate assumes the responsibility for supporting the clinical team under the supervision of the BCBA in the development of behavior plans, behavioral analysis of selected target behaviors, education of staff in plan procedures, facilitating skill acquisition groups post-master’s completion, supporting the family/caregiver with behavioral training, providing appropriate referrals and resources for aftercare support post discharge. The Behavior Analyst Associate maintains knowledge of, participates in further training provided, and understands the potential risks regarding occupational health hazards (e.g. bloodborne pathogen exposures).

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

· Enhances the delivery of effective and measurable behavioral treatment to patients.

· Collaborate with RNs, Psychiatrists, and other members of the treatment team to decrease maladaptive behaviors observed.

· Data collection forms, procedures, monitoring and analysis.

· Assists in the development of behavioral assessment and behavioral treatment protocols under the supervision of the BCBA.

· Performs indirect and direct assessments of selected target behaviors.

· Coordinates behavioral assessment and treatment protocols for selected patients.

· Responds to escalated behaviors and crisis level behaviors to de-escalate, support, and reduce harm.

· Provide training and staff education on managing challenging behaviors using replacement behaviors, positive reinforcement, and other principles and procedures.

· Participate in case conferences and on-going meetings as necessary for certain patients.

· Prepares and maintains data collection sheets, other forms for data analysis.

· Documents services provided using electronic medical record system.

· Consults other departments as appropriate to collaborate on patient care and performance improvement activities.

· Facilitates groups post-master’s degree towards skill acquisition, including social skills, ADL support, behavior modification, sensory regulation, etc.

· Participates in regular meetings with Clinical leadership members to provide program updates.

· Upholds the Organization's ethics and customer service standards.

Requirements

POSITION REQUIREMENTS:

Knowledge and Experience:

· Enrolled in or completion of a Master’s degree program in Behavioral Analysis, Psychology, or similar.

· On track towards Certification from the Behavior Analyst Certification Board as a Board-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A).

· Minimum one (1) year experience in the provision of behavioral analysis and behavior analytic treatment.

· Handle With Care certification required, or obtained within initial orientation period.

· Current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) certification required, or obtained within initial orientation period.
